Q: What is a relay, and how does it work?

A: A relay is an electromagnetic switch that uses an energized coil to open or close a circuit. When the coil is energized, it creates a magnetic field that pulls a contact armature towards it, closing a set of electrical contacts. When the coil is de-energized, the magnetic field collapses, and the contact armature returns to its original position, opening the contacts.

Q: What are the types of relays? A: There are many types of relays, including electromagnetic relays, solid-state relays, thermal relays, reed relays, and time-delay relays, among others. Each type of relay has its unique design and application.

Q: What is the purpose of a relay? A: The primary purpose of a relay is to switch electrical circuits on and off. It is commonly used in control circuits to control high-power loads or where a signal from a low-power circuit is used to control a higher power load.

Q: What are the advantages of using a relay? A: Relays offer several advantages, including isolation of the controlling circuit from the controlled circuit, the ability to switch high power loads with low power circuits, and the ability to switch multiple circuits simultaneously.
